Question 3: What are the risks associated with getting implants?

There are a number of risks associated with getting implants, including:

  • Bleeding
  • Infection
  • Scarring
  • Implant rupture
  • Breastfeeding problems

Tip 5: Get regular mammograms.

After you have implants, it is important to get regular mammograms to screen for breast cancer. Mammograms can be more difficult to interpret after implants, so it is important to find a radiologist who is experienced in reading mammograms of women with implants.
